Dessert in 5 minutes! No oven, no gelatin and no flour
Ingredients
- 250 g of biscuits
- 120 g of melted butter
- 400 g of spreadable cheese
- 50 g of icing sugar
- 300 g of white chocolate
- 450 g of 33% cream
How to prepare the timeless dessert
- First, break 250 g of dry biscuits into the blender glass, grind them to obtain a powder . Then pour them into a bowl and add 120 g of melted butter and mix with a spoon to mix everything well.
- Once this is done, take the mixture you just obtained and pour it into an 18 cm diameter pan greased and lined with parchment paper and level with a spoon. Now, place it in the fridge for 30 minutes to rest.
- In the meantime, take a bowl and pour 400 g of spreadable cheese into it and mix it with the double electric whisk. Then add 50 g of icing sugar and 150 g of melted white chocolate. Mix everything with the double electric whisk.
- In a different bowl, mix 300 g of 33% cream with an electric whisk and then, once whipped, add it to the mixture prepared earlier and mix carefully with the help of a spatula. Everything must be well blended.
- Take the pan with the dough back from the fridge, add the mixture you just made, spread it well, level it and put it back in the fridge for 3 hours.
- At this point, put the 150 g of white chocolate in a bowl and melt it in a bain-marie. In another bowl put 150 g of 33% cream. Then add the cream to the melted chocolate and mix, mixing well with a spoon.
- Then take the pan with the cake out of the fridge, unzip the pan and remove the parchment paper from the edge. Now pour the chocolate cream over it, distributing it well and letting it fall down the edges. Decorate with crumbled biscuits on top and refrigerate for another 30 minutes.
And here the cake is ready.
